Popular actor and producer Azeez Ijaduade has been discharged from the hospital following a near-death experience after being hit by a bullet fired by a police officer in Iperu area of Ogun state.

The incident occurred last week where the single bullet pierced not just the metal of his car but also his neck, leaving him battling for breath and survival.

The producer, who documented the harrowing incident with a video showing the bullet’s path through his car, expressed gratitude to God for what he termed His unspeakable intervention.

He added that for days, he was in shock and couldn’t figure out how the incident occurred on the faithful day.

Ijaduade acknowledged the torrent of love and support tendered him by fans and well wishers across the country and in the diaspora.

According to him, the gestures showered on him helped to navigate the difficult period and the frightening situation towards his recovery.

Specifically, the movie star commended the Theatre Arts and Motion Pictures Practitioners Association of Nigeria (TAMPAN) and media organizations for their unalloyed support.

He disclosed that he will forever be grateful to those who stood by him during the challenging time.
